Francesco Camarda’s name has been known in AC Milan spheres for years now, and the striker debuted last season at 15 years old. Now, at 17, the world is at his feet still.

The past few years have felt like a bit of a whirlwind, especially with Camarda, and it would be fair to suggest that it does not feel like the striker is still only 17. A prominent figure around the senior team, the youngster is very much the man of Milan’s future.

So, with today being a special day, Pianeta Milan have recapped some things. Last season was one of ‘true revelation’ as the site writes, making his debut among the big boys whilst still dominating in the youth scene.

Then, you have the summer of success with the Italian national team in the European Championship which further proved his ability as one of the best youngsters in the world.

This season, he has seen more continuity in his playing time in Serie A, and whilst not the man just yet, he has still shown himself to be a more than viable option for the side when needed. Furthermore, he was inches away from his first goal – against Club Brugge – more proof that he is ready for the big leagues.

Today being his birthday acts as a fantastic reminder. Most professionals will play until their early 30s, and touch wood, the same fact remains true for Camarda.

That is 13 years away still, Camarda is still, very much the future and the Rossoneri are ‘betting big’ on him, strange considering he can’t legally gamble yet himself, another reminder of his youth.
